The Russell County Board of Supervisors held a meeting on March 30, 2026, where several procurement and budget-related matters were discussed. A significant portion of the meeting focused on public safety funding, including a request from the Copper Creek and Moxon Volunteer Fire Department for financial assistance to cover the purchase and operational costs of a pumper truck (Engine 49) costing approximately $112,000. The board expressed support and discussed potential funding sources, including casino funds. Additionally, funding requests were made for community programs addressing substance abuse prevention and recovery, with motions passed to allocate $12,000 to the Communities in Schools program and over $53,000 for recovery house fees and classroom resources from drug abatement funds. The board also discussed options for a countywide forensic audit, ultimately voting to pursue a free audit through the Office of the Inspector General rather than a costly private forensic audit. Other procurement topics included approval of an RFP for grant administration services related to the Three Rivers Destination Center project funded by DHCD. Road maintenance and infrastructure projects were reviewed, including a resolution for a road closure related to a tank hollow road project. The meeting included citizen comments on public safety, quarry permitting, and transparency in county finances. Motions were passed for committee appointments and to approve meeting minutes. Overall, the meeting addressed multiple procurement and budget decisions impacting public safety, community services, infrastructure, and financial oversight.
